Apart from mastitis, breast stinging pain during breastfeeding may also be caused by mastalgia, cystic hyperplasia of the breast, fibroadenoma of the breast, inflammatory breast cancer, etc. It is recommended to go to the hospital for further examination. 1. Mastalgia: It can be characterized by periodic breast swelling and pain, and a lump can be detected on palpation. 2. Cystic hyperplasia of the breast: its symptoms are similar to those of mastalgia, but there is usually no breast dysmorphism, which can be differentiated by pathological examination. 3. Breast fibroadenoma: the main symptom is breast lump, and some pathology can be accompanied by pain. 4. Inflammatory breast cancer: in addition to pain, it also manifests as localized skin redness, swelling, heat and enlarged lymph nodes. In addition, cardiothoracic diseases, herpes zoster, breast trauma and so on may also appear similar manifestations, and it is recommended to go to the hospital in time.
